I have just begun experimenting with the GEOS functions now available in
4.10 via mapscript and have a question.

Can shape objects from layer object A be passed as arguments to shape object
methods in layer object B? (Each layer has a separate shape file)

I am trying to create a function that determines if shape A (district) is
within shape B (province), as stated above both layers are separate layers
in separate shape files.

I know I have the objects needed as both can be output using print_r(), I
know the method is working as if I pass a shape object from the same layer I
get the results as expected.

Is it just the case that shape objects from different layers or shape files
can’t be passed as objects to shapeObj methods? If so it there any feasible
way around this or am I just going to have to put both districts and
provinces in the same layer and output them through class references?
